This week i still worked on finishing up the Bauplatform information.  I ran into a little snag about how the pictures I used might have not been for public use and if they were then I didn't cite the author.  So the first thing I had to do this week was double check where I got them from and then talk to Claudia about whether or not we were going to be able to use them.  It was all news to me about the copyright for the pictures.  I was under the impression that if it you were able to copy the picture and paste it somewhere else then it was available to the public, because if websites don't want you to use their pictures they make it so you can't copy them at all.  So I gues I learned something I didn't know before.  And good thing to obecause companies will look to sue you if they catch you using their picture without permission.
